Am I correct in assuming that all Master System Carts are the same Size/Shape,
and all Master System Cart Manuals are the same Height and Width?

I own all but 2 USA Master System games, and I've at least seen those 2, and all carts are the same size.  As for manuals, there isn't any real consistency, but they are all close enough that if you base your size on one, it will fit them all (as we are talking millimeters).  The biggest variant is the Sega Card games, like Ghost House, My Hero, Teddy Boy, etc.  The existing Sega Card game cases will only hold a card in place if it's in its original plastic sleeve.  If there's no sleeve, the Sega Card won't snap into place.  Most copies of Sega Card games I've seen, the plastic sleeve is long gone.  So you would need to decide if you want to design around the sleeve being there or not.  I have a few EUR titles and they have identical dimensions, carts and manuals both.  Though, JAP games are entirely different, and even have a different pinout on the cartridges themselves.  Unfortunately, I don't have any to provide dimensions.

Are all of the Manuals and Carts for 32X The same size and shape?

Same slight manual variations as mentioned for the Sega Master System, and I have all but 2 US carts, but have again at least seen those, and they are all identical in size.

These games have a special cart with a built in Multi-tap
Pete Sampras Tennis
Pete Sampras Tennis 96
Micro Machines 2
Micro Machines 96
Micro Machines Military Edition
Super Skidmarks

There's also the Codemasters carts for the SMS:


And in case you want dimensions for Mark III and SG-1000 carts, they measure 4.3 inches (10.922 cm) tall, 3.5 inches (8.89 cm) wide, and 0.7 inches (1.778 cm) thick.

The only tape measures I have handy are in imperial units, so for that, I apologize.

Saturn NetLink Cart
4 3/8" W
4 15/16" H
5/8" D (at the bottom and at the top, with a 1" depth in the modem area)

Saturn Action Replay Plus 4M Cart
4 3/8" W
3 1/8" H
5/8" D

The parallel port up top adds an additional 3/16" height in the top center of the cart.
